ODYSSEUS Model Overview

ODYSSEUS is a 3.1 billion parameter language model developed by bijoy0236. It is an instruction-tuned variant, building upon the unsloth/qwen2.5-3b-instruct-unsloth-bnb-4bit base model. A key characteristic of ODYSSEUS is its training methodology: it was finetuned using Unsloth and Hugging Face's TRL library, which enabled a 2x faster training process compared to standard methods.

Key Characteristics

  • Base Model: Finetuned from unsloth/qwen2.5-3b-instruct-unsloth-bnb-4bit.
  • Parameter Count: 3.1 billion parameters, offering a balance between performance and computational efficiency.
  • Training Efficiency: Utilizes Unsloth for significantly faster training, making it an efficient choice for deployment.
  • Context Length: Supports a context length of 32768 tokens.
